The start is at the large car park at Les Dappes.
(S/E) Enter the pasture and head left. Pass under the small ski lift and follow the signposts to an intersection where the path splits.
(1) Turn right and head up the slope, which gradually becomes steeper. Follow the multiple tracks on the ground, making sure to keep going in the same direction, until you reach the road leading to the farm and cross it.
(2) Turn right, heading south-southwest on the most visible trail.
(3) Turn left at the edge of the woods and begin a steeper climb. On the flat section, look for the fork in the path.
(4) Take the right-hand track and climb up to join a path coming from Col de Porte. Continue to the right and reach the summit of La Dôle.
(5) Enjoy the site and the view and rest your legs before starting the descent. After the orientation table, walk past the dome buildings and then the weather station and take the path that runs along the dry stone wall in a south-westerly direction. You will reach a fork on the ridge (elevation 1625).
(6) Turn left, descend into a pretty little valley and continue along this uneven but clearly visible path. After crossing a more wooded area, you will come out below the scree slopes coming down from the summit. Go around the cistern and you will come to a less visible crossroads.
(7) Continue straight ahead into the pasture, leaving the Chalet de la Dôle on your right. Shortly afterwards, you will reach another intersection (elevation 1423).
(8) Turn right onto the steep slope towards the Chalet des Apprentis. Reach the summit and a crossroads (elevation 1463).
(9) Continue straight ahead, passing below the Chalet des Apprentis. Descend into the valley and continue until you reach the road leading to the Vuarne farm.
(10) Turn right onto the tarmac road and reach the entrance to the forest (elevation 1259).
(11) Take the path on the left that descends and then crosses the previous road. Continue straight ahead towards a chalet and picnic tables. You will reach the entrance to the hamlet of Saint-Cergue.
(12) At the junction between the chairlift and Vuarne roads, turn left. Once you have come out of a left-hand bend, take a path that branches off to the right into the meadows and enters a pasture: the footpath is located on the far left behind some large trees. Continue along this path to reach the hamlet of Couvaloup de Saint-Cergue. Go down the small road (Chemin des Polonais) and negotiate the right-hand bend.
(13) Before reaching the crossroads, take a barely visible path on the left and descend into the valley. Stay on the most marked path and, at the lowest point, turn right. Continue until you reach a small road.
(14) Cross it and continue straight ahead across the fields until you reach a junction near the main road.
(15) Continue straight ahead and then turn left shortly afterwards. Leave the farm access road on your left and continue until the path splits in two.
(16) Keep left and continue straight ahead to return to the first intersection at the start.
(1) Continue straight ahead to return to the car park (S/E).
